Developer Pools 24 FL Properties in $130M Bond Deal
Greystone Affordable Housing Initiatives announced the closing of a $130 million multifamily housing transaction in Florida. The statewide pooled transaction involves 24 aged U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Rural Development Sec. 515 properties, comprising 1,058 apartment homes serving low-income households in 12 counties. They are owned and operated by The Hallmark Cos.
FL Cat Fund in Best Financial Shape Ever
The Florida Hurricane Catastrophe Fund says it's in its best financial shape ever, though $454 million in damage claims have been filed across the state because of Hurricane Matthew.
Insider Reveals Deceptive Strategy Behind FL's Solar Amendment
The Florida Supreme Court approved the Amendment 1 language in a 4-3 vote, concluding the proposal was not misleading but did enshrine into the Constitution protections consumers already had. Justice Pariente, in her dissenting opinion, called the language "a wolf in sheep's clothing" because it would allow utilities to raise fees on solar customers and was "masquerading as a pro-solar energy initiative."
Venice City Council Seeks County Grant Funds to Revitalize Seaboard Area
The Venice City Council agreed Monday to seek county grant funds to help revitalize the Seaboard area of the city. Specifically, the council is hoping for Sarasota County's assistance to pay for a study of the area between the Intracoastal Waterway and U.S. 41 Bypass, from the north driveway of Venetia Bay Boulevard, south to Center Road.
Florida Community Loan Fund Providing $13.5M to Lotus House
Homelessness is a large problem in Miami and Lotus House provides a shelter and support system to homeless women, youth and children. The Florida Community Loan Fund is helping them finance expansion of their buildings and rehabilitation of their deteriorating structures.
Miami to Meet Oct. 13 to Review SEC Settlement
Miami officials will hold a special meeting with attorneys to determine whether to accept a settlement with the Securities and Exchange Commission in light of a verdict finding the city guilty of securities fraud.
